    It depends on your choice which one suits you better like if you want to deindex a page or directory from Google’s Search Results then I suggest that you use a “Noindex” meta tag rather than a robots.txt whereas Robots.txt files are best for disallowing a whole section of a site, such as a category whereas a meta tag is more efficient at disallowing single files and pages.

    Robots.txt is a standard used by websites to communicate with web crawlers and other web robots. The standard specifies how to inform the web robot about which areas of the website should not be processed or scanned.

    To check which pages are crawled into the search engine and which are not you just need to type in URL section as,

    domain name/robots.txt
    Meta robots tag is a tag that tells search engines what to follow and what not to follow. It is a piece of code in the <head> section of your webpage. It's a simple code that gives you the power to decide about what pages you want to hide from search engine crawlers and what pages you want them to index and look at.
